Karachi’s famed Assistant Commissioner, Hazim Bangwar, left a career in Hollywood to serve his country

Hazim Bangwar, the assistant commissioner for North Nazimabad, used to write songs and sell them to big music labels and Hollywood singers while in college to earn some money. He revealed that he has worked with Nicki Minaj, Jesse J, and Ariana Grande to name a few. But decided to return to Pakistan to serve his country.

Bangwar made a guest appearance on The Mathira Show where he spoke about his upbringing in the UK, and the United States and why he left his rather luxurious life, which featured limousines and record labels, to become a commissioner in Pakistan.

The 29-year-old exclaimed that the deteriorating quality of life in Pakistan made him come back.  “I’d think that ‘I’m travelling first class in Emirates and here people are struggling to travel in public buses… ‘What am I doing?’ I’d ask myself… Somewhere, I felt like I was wasting time and not doing enough.”
